Water supply restored in Kyiv

The mayor of kyiv Vitali Klitschko, on Telegram estimated that “the water supply of the houses of the inhabitants of kyiv has been fully restored”. With the bombings of the day before, up to 80% of the inhabitants of the capital had been deprived of it. Regarding electricity, the city will maintain cuts due to the “electrical system deficit”.

Russians expand civilian evacuation zones in Kherson

Russian officials in the Kherson region of southern Ukraine said they were expanding an evacuation zone further from the Dnipro River. In a message on Telegram, Vladimir Saldo, the region’s Russian-backed leader said he was extending the area covered by an order to evacuate civilians by another 15 km.

Oil tanker Saudi Aramco benefits from soaring prices

Saudi Aramco posts a 39% jump in profits in the third quarter year on year. These results were boosted by higher oil prices largely resulting from the Russian invasion of Ukraine. The energy giant’s net income was $42.4 billion.

Russia wants “commitments” from Ukraine on the demilitarization of the grain corridor

Russia’s military said on Monday it wanted ‘commitments’ from Ukraine not to use the grain export corridor for military purposes, after an attack on its fleet in Crimea and the suspension of the agreement for their delivery . “There can be no question of guaranteeing the security of anything in this area until Ukraine makes additional commitments not to use this road for military purposes,” the Russian Defense Ministry said on Telegram.

Washington calls Moscow’s demand to demilitarize the grain corridor an “extortion”

The United States has called “collective extortion” Moscow’s demands on Ukraine not to use the corridor intended for grain exports for military purposes, after an attack on its fleet in Crimea and the suspension of the agreement for their delivery. “It looks like either collective punishment or collective extortion,” said US State Department spokesman Ned Price.

IAEA announces start of inspections in Ukraine

The International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) announced on Monday evening that it had begun its inspections in Ukraine, requested by this country after Russian President Vladimir Putin accused it of erasing evidence of the preparation of a “bomb dirty “. IAEA inspectors have “begun – and will soon complete – verifying the activities of two sites in Ukraine,” the Vienna-based UN agency said in a statement.
